Location: Hybrid (within commutable distance to Media, PA) Schedule: 8am-5pm, Monday - Friday POSITION SUMMARY:  Performs functions by coordinating financial data for use in maintaining accounting records for vendors

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: Reviews all invoices for appropriate documentation and approval prior to processing for payment Charges expenses to designated accounts and cost centers by reviewing invoice/expense reports; records entries Verifies that transactions comply with financial policies and procedures Performs data entry of invoices for payment Pays vendors by monitoring discount opportunities, verifying federal ID numbers and scheduling and preparing checks Resolves purchase order, contract, invoice, or payment discrepancies and documentation, ensures credit is received for outstanding memos and issues stop-payments or purchase order amendments Processes employee expense reports and requests for advances in compliance with financial policies and procedures and prepares corresponding checks Verifies vendor accounts by reconciling monthly statements and related transactions Maintains historical records by scanning and filing documents Answers all vendor inquiries Performs other related duties as required

IMMEDIATE SUPERVISOR: Controller DIRECT REPORTS: None

CONTACTS: Elwyn staff; vendors

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E/SKILLS REQUIREMENTS: One year related experience and/or training, or equivalent combination of education and experience; Associate's Degree or equivalent from a two-year college or technical school preferred Ability to read and interpret documents such as procedure manuals, saf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ions Ability to write routine reports and correspondence Good listening and communication skills Attention To Detail Ability to calculate figures and amounts such as discounts, interest, commissions, proportions and percentages Proficiency with MS Outlook required; Experience with general ledger software (i.e. Navision) preferred Demonstrated proficiency with data entry Ability to interpret a variety of instructions furnished in written, oral or schedule form PHYSICAL DEMANDS/ENVIRONMENTAL PROFILE: The work environment is conducted within a defined, typically indoor office setting, where standard office equipment--including computers, printers, and cellular devices--is utilized. The role involves extended periods of sitting. Regular communication through talking, listening, and written correspondence is essential.
